- Josef_Vratislav_Monse abstract "Josef Vratislav Monse (June 15, 1733 – February 6, 1793) was a Moravian lawyer and historian.He was a leading enlightenment figure in the Habsburg Monarchy and an early exponent of the Czech National Revival in Moravia. Monse played a key role in the development of modern Moravian Historiography. He was a professor of law and, in 1780, the rector at the University of Olomouc.".
